Output ead62e112a442ea1bc1cc151577af6374c2fa944a0ed30fc43c7477a3a6b9904:26

value
873000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ed6149dec5973621e3ede2c303d4dc0860a7144b OP_EQUAL
address
3PLAcjaUE29aPmV3eRZ4P3nRUn91o3eQqA
transaction
ead62e112a442ea1bc1cc151577af6374c2fa944a0ed30fc43c7477a3a6b9904
spent
true